In this role, you will:
Own the analyst narrative: develop and continuously evolve a clear, credible analyst storyline aligned with Grant Thornton Advisors' commercial strategy, roadmap and growth priorities
Proactively engage top-tier analysts: build and maintain strong relationships with key global analysts across firms such as Gartner, Forrester, IDC, Everest Group, TBR and specialist industry analysts, actively shaping coverage rather than responding to it
Influence perception and positioning: monitor analyst research, reports and commentary. Identify opportunities to correct misconceptions, strengthen positioning and elevate differentiation versus competitors
Lead the firm's response to ratings cycles: Magic Quadrant, Forrester Wave, IDC MarketScape and Everest PEAK Matrix
Advise senior leaders: prepare executives for analyst interactions, including message framing, Q&A and positioning around sensitive or emerging topics
Partner cross-functionally: act as a connector across Service Line Marketing, Communications, Technology and the wider business, ensuring consistency between analyst, media and investor narratives
Identify opportunities where analyst commentary supports pursuits and priority deals
Design and manage analyst advocacy programmes, including participation in firm events and advisory boards
Set KPIs for analyst relations effectiveness and report regularly to the CMO and firm leadership
Manage the analyst relations budget, subscriptions and agency relationships to maximise commercial impact
